Over 6,300 votes were cast, and the final buzzer has sounded! The confetti is floating through the air! Your 3rd Annual Tournament of Books Champions are The Lightning Thief series by Rick Riordan, and on the Teen side, the Legend trilogy by Marie Lu! The voting on the Juvenile side was a slam-dunk, with Percy Jackson outscoring runner-up, The Day the Crayons Quit, by a 2 to 1 margin. On the Teen side, however, it was a buzzer beater, much like Villanova’s win over North Carolina in the NCAA Championship Game on Monday night, with the Legend trilogy squeaking past The Hunger Games trilogy by only ONE vote!
Along the way, The Lightning Thief series outscored the graphic novel series, Amulet, in the first round by a wide margin (over 2oo vote difference); in the second round, it beat Drama by over 100 votes. In the Exciting Eight round, it was up against another famous series, Harry Potter, and again was the clear winner. In our Favorite Four, it faced the Diary of a Wimpy Kid series and continued to outpace its opponent by over 200 votes. In the Championship round, Percy Jackson battled a box of crayons and it was never even close!
In the Teen competition, the Legend series had an easy first match against 13 Reasons Why, but faced stiffer competition against Life as We Knew It in the second round. The Exciting Eight found Legend up against The Outsiders and it outscored its opponent by only 40 votes, but regained its game face in the Favorite Four, when it faced The Book Thief and was a clear winner. In that Championship round, though, Legend had to dig deep to face its fiercest rival, The Hunger Games series, and ultimately emerged victorious!
